What is a Wi Fi test engineer?

Wi Fi Test Engineers are professionals responsible for evaluating and ensuring the performance, reliability, and security of Wi Fi networks and devices. They design and execute test plans, analyze results, and troubleshoot issues related to wireless connectivity. Their work helps ensure that Wi Fi-enabled products, such as routers, smartphones, and IoT devices, meet industry standards and provide a seamless user experience. These engineers often collaborate with developers, network specialists, and quality assurance teams.

What are some typical challenges Wi Fi test engineers face when validating new wireless devices?

Wi Fi Test Engineers often encounter challenges such as dealing with signal interference, ensuring compatibility with various devices and network environments, and troubleshooting intermittent connectivity issues. They must carefully design tests to account for real-world conditions like physical obstructions and multiple user scenarios. Collaboration with hardware and software teams is crucial to resolve issues quickly and keep projects on schedule. Staying updated with evolving Wi Fi standards and certification requirements is also an ongoing part of the role.

Overview 
 
The client's connected beds and stretchers carry an onboard Gateway module providing Wi-Fi and Bluetooth connectivity between the device and the hospital network, backend servers, endpoints, and clinical applications. 
 
These devices operate in one of the most hostile RF environments: dense enterprise wireless deployments, heavy 2.4 GHz congestion, continuous roaming as beds move between floors and wings, and no tolerance for dropped clinical data. This role owns wireless verification of the Gateway โ€” RF characterization, protocol and system-level connectivity testing, interoperability, and root-cause support when field issues are traced to the wireless stack. 
 
Responsibilities 
 
RF & PHY characterization 
 
Conducted and radiated RF test: transmit power, receive sensitivity, EVM, spectral mask, frequency accuracy, spurious emissions across supported bands and modulation schemes 
Characterize throughput and packet error rate against controlled attenuation; establish range and link-budget envelopes 
Operate and maintain RF infrastructure โ€” shielded enclosures and chambers, programmable attenuator matrices, spectrum analyzers, vector signal analyzers and generators 
Protocol & system-level connectivity 
 
Verify association, authentication, and key exchange across WPA2/WPA3-Enterprise, 802.1X/EAP variants, certificate handling, and PSK modes 
Test roaming across access points including fast transition (802.11r/k/v), band steering, and roaming thresholds; characterize handoff latency and session continuity for a device physically moving through a facility 
Verify DHCP, DNS, IP stack behavior, reconnection after network loss, recovery from AP or backhaul outage 
Measure throughput, latency, jitter, packet loss under load, interference, and multi-client contention 
Test Bluetooth/BLE coexistence with Wi-Fi in the 2.4 GHz band 
Interoperability 
 
Execute interoperability matrices across enterprise infrastructure vendors (Cisco, Aruba/HPE, Meraki, Extreme, Juniper Mist) and across controller firmware revisions 
Build and maintain representative hospital-network test environments 
Debug & root cause 
 
Capture and analyze wireless traffic (Wireshark, dedicated 802.11 capture adapters, vendor sniffers) and correlate with device-side logs 
Reproduce field-reported connectivity issues in the lab, isolating between application, network stack, Wi-Fi driver, firmware, and RF layers 
Work with embedded firmware and driver teams on defect isolation and fix verification 
Automation 
 
Automate wireless test execution and data collection in Python โ€” instrument control, AP configuration, traffic generation, log parsing, results reporting 
Interface with the device under test over CAN and serial for state control, telemetry, and log capture during wireless runs 
Contribute to regression suites so wireless verification runs repeatably 
Regulatory & standards support 
 
Support pre-compliance scanning and evidence generation for FCC / ISED / CE radio submissions 
Support coexistence testing and risk assessment per ANSI C63.27 and AAMI TIR69 
Produce protocols, reports, and traceability artifacts to design-control standards 
Required 
 
5+ years Wi-Fi / RF test engineering on embedded or connected hardware 
802.11 depth: protocol-level knowledge of a/b/g/n/ac/ax โ€” frame types, management/control/data flows, association and authentication state machines, rate adaptation, channel and bandwidth behavior 
RF instrumentation: spectrum analyzers, vector signal analyzers/generators, power meters, programmable attenuators, shielded chambers 
Security modes: WPA2/WPA3, 802.1X/EAP (PEAP, EAP-TLS), certificate-based enterprise authentication 
Traffic & capture: iPerf or comparable; Wireshark and 802.11 packet capture โ€” able to read a capture and reach a conclusion from it 
Enterprise Wi-Fi: practical AP and controller configuration; RF planning, channel reuse, roaming design 
Python: automation-grade for instrument control, test orchestration, log and data analysis 
Embedded interfaces: CAN, serial console/UART for device control and log capture 
Able to work onsite in Kalamazoo for the full engagement 
Preferred 
 
Medical device experience โ€” design controls, ISO 13485, IEC 62304, ISO 14971, IEC 60601-1-2 EMC 
AAMI TIR69 and ANSI C63.27 coexistence methodology 
Wi-Fi Alliance certification process 
Linux wireless stack โ€” cfg80211/mac80211, driver and supplicant behavior, wpa_supplicant debugging (high value: client's field issues have historically traced to driver-layer behavior) 
Embedded Linux BSP exposure on custom hardware 
Bluetooth/BLE test experience 
CWNA/CWAP, CCNA Wireless, or equivalent 
Wireless devices deployed in hospital or high-density enterprise environments 
Screening note 
 
The standout candidate can move down the stack not just run a test plan and report pass/fail, but take a packet capture, correlate against driver logs, and articulate where in the stack the behavior originates. Screen on 802.11 protocol behavior, roaming and coexistence scenarios, packet capture interpretation, and RF measurement fundamentals.
